• Recent
  • Tags
  • Popular
  • Home
  • Docs
  • Register
  • Login
RetroPie forum home
  • Recent
  • Tags
  • Popular
  • Home
  • Docs
  • Register
  • Login
Please do not post a support request without first reading and following the advice in https://retropie.org.uk/forum/topic/3/read-this-first

Can't download themes or emulators error 'tar -xv -z -C

Scheduled Pinned Locked Moved Help and Support
errorhelp me pleaseraspberry pi 0tar -xv -z -chelp
21 Posts 3 Posters 3.1k Views
Loading More Posts
  • Oldest to Newest
  • Newest to Oldest
  • Most Votes
Reply
  • Reply as topic
Log in to reply
This topic has been deleted. Only users with topic management privileges can see it.
  • E
    edgarsv
    last edited by 27 Jun 2018, 09:35

    Some months ago I got my retro pie 4.3 on my raspberry pi zero. A while ago I bought an adapter (Ethernet to usb). (I checked adapter it works) Firstly I did scraping. It worked. then I tried to download themes there was an error. then I tried to download some emulators but then the error was shown:
    Error running 'tar -xv -C
    /home/pi/RetroPie-Setup/tmp/build/fuse
    --strip-components 1' - returned 2

    then something new appeared:
    please see
    /home/pi/RetroPie-Setup/logs/rps_2017-07-08_123928 . log. g
    z for more in depth information regarding the errors .

    and:
    fuse patch cursor .diff failed to apply

    • Also when script was going I catched a line * enable to conect to github.com*
    • Also (/home/pi/RetroPie-Setup/tmp/build/fuse) <--- i don't know what is that or where to find it or whrite it, Could you explain?
    • Also I havent done networking conection with my pc. (I don't know what to do..) I put my roms with usb flash drive.

    What should I do? I'm kinda new to retropie so I now a little... For the problem's soloution should i update retropie to version 4.4? Is that the issue?
    Please help!!!

    1 Reply Last reply Reply Quote 0
    • M
      mitu Global Moderator
      last edited by 27 Jun 2018, 10:22

      It looks like you don't have an internet connection - or a stable connection - from your PI system and this is causing your problems. Check if your internet connection is working correctly before attempting to update or download additional emulators.

      E 1 Reply Last reply 27 Jun 2018, 10:37 Reply Quote 0
      • E
        edgarsv @mitu
        last edited by 27 Jun 2018, 10:37

        @mitu Before connecting the adapter I checked it with my pc first (and it worked. And the scraper works fine. Does the old retropie version (4.3) affects something?
        And does this line /home/pi/RetroPie-Setup/tmp/build/fuse is for computer networking?

        M 1 Reply Last reply 27 Jun 2018, 10:44 Reply Quote 0
        • M
          mitu Global Moderator @edgarsv
          last edited by 27 Jun 2018, 10:44

          @edgarsv said in Can't download themes or emulators error 'tar -xv -z -C:

          And does this line /home/pi/RetroPie-Setup/tmp/build/fuse is for computer networking?

          No, this is a folder where the RetroPie script tries to download the emulator's sources in order to build and install it, but obviously fails.
          Just because the adapter works from the PC, doesn't mean it works correctly in RetroPie. If you use the RetroPie system and choose Show IP address, what's the output ?

          1 Reply Last reply Reply Quote 0
          • E
            edgarsv
            last edited by 27 Jun 2018, 11:20

            here is the image of ip address 0_1530098340787_20180627_141739.jpg

            M 1 Reply Last reply 27 Jun 2018, 11:30 Reply Quote 0
            • M
              mitu Global Moderator @edgarsv
              last edited by 27 Jun 2018, 11:30

              @edgarsv You seem to have an internal (LAN) IP on the adapter, so the adapter seems to work. If you try to update the RetroPie script, does it work ?

              1 Reply Last reply Reply Quote 0
              • E
                edgarsv
                last edited by 27 Jun 2018, 11:38

                No it doesn't I think... This is what it shows ...!0_1530099466309_20180627_143631.jpg

                M 1 Reply Last reply 27 Jun 2018, 11:42 Reply Quote 0
                • M
                  mitu Global Moderator @edgarsv
                  last edited by 27 Jun 2018, 11:42

                  @edgarsv It looks like either your date/time is off (which kind of is, based on your first screenshot) or your installation is too old and it's missing the necessary CA info to validate the HTTPS connection's certificate to github.com.

                  Try updating the ca-certificates package and make sure your date and time are correct. Run this from the command line or from an SSH session.

                  # update ca-certificates
                  sudo apt-get update
                  sudo apt-get -y install ca-certificates
                  # Check the date/time
                  date
                  1 Reply Last reply Reply Quote 0
                  • E
                    edgarsv
                    last edited by 27 Jun 2018, 11:57

                    Here is how it worked...
                    0_1530100542996_20180627_145253.jpg
                    The only part I understood was that the date is wrong.

                    1 Reply Last reply Reply Quote 0
                    • M
                      mitu Global Moderator
                      last edited by 27 Jun 2018, 12:00

                      Try setting the date from the internet

                      sudo systemctl stop ntp
                      sudo ntpdate 2.debian.pool.ntp.org
                      # Check the date again
                      date
                      1 Reply Last reply Reply Quote 0
                      • E
                        edgarsv
                        last edited by 27 Jun 2018, 12:06

                        After first command nothing happened but after the 2nd command it said command not found

                        E 1 Reply Last reply 27 Jun 2018, 12:11 Reply Quote 0
                        • E
                          edgarsv @edgarsv
                          last edited by 27 Jun 2018, 12:11

                          0_1530101457341_20180627_150921.jpg @edgarsv

                          M 1 Reply Last reply 27 Jun 2018, 12:39 Reply Quote 0
                          • M
                            mitu Global Moderator @edgarsv
                            last edited by 27 Jun 2018, 12:39

                            @edgarsv Try installing the ntpdate command with

                            sudo apt-get -y install ntpdate
                            

                            and then retry to set the date.

                            1 Reply Last reply Reply Quote 0
                            • E
                              edgarsv
                              last edited by 27 Jun 2018, 13:16

                              I did what you told but the date didn't change saying 8 Jul 15:48:38 ntpdate[1531]: no server suitable for synchronization found

                              M 1 Reply Last reply 27 Jun 2018, 13:39 Reply Quote 0
                              • M
                                mitu Global Moderator @edgarsv
                                last edited by 27 Jun 2018, 13:39

                                @edgarsv Try with the well known NIST time server:

                                sudo ntpdate time.nist.gov
                                
                                1 Reply Last reply Reply Quote 0
                                • E
                                  edgarsv
                                  last edited by 27 Jun 2018, 14:55

                                  That didn't work either... Is there a way to set by my self? What could the reason for it not founding the servers?

                                  M 1 Reply Last reply 27 Jun 2018, 15:47 Reply Quote 0
                                  • M
                                    mitu Global Moderator @edgarsv
                                    last edited by 27 Jun 2018, 15:47

                                    @edgarsv You can set the date with timedatectl - see https://wiki.archlinux.org/index.php/Time#Set_system_clock. But I suspect the problem is that your internet connection is not working correctly, RetroPie would have set the time and date automatically from the internet.

                                    1 Reply Last reply Reply Quote 0
                                    • B
                                      BuZz administrators
                                      last edited by 27 Jun 2018, 16:00

                                      Probably easiest to just start with a 4.4 image - Jessie support will be dropped by us in the future anyway.

                                      To help us help you - please make sure you read the sticky topics before posting - https://retropie.org.uk/forum/topic/3/read-this-first

                                      1 Reply Last reply Reply Quote 0
                                      • E
                                        edgarsv
                                        last edited by 27 Jun 2018, 16:17

                                        So... What should I do?

                                        1 Reply Last reply Reply Quote 0
                                        • E
                                          edgarsv
                                          last edited by 27 Jun 2018, 16:42

                                          Should I change retropie's version to 4.4? or try to replase raspberry pi zero to raspberry pi 3?

                                          1 Reply Last reply Reply Quote 0
                                          20 out of 21
                                          • First post
                                            20/21
                                            Last post

                                          Contributions to the project are always appreciated, so if you would like to support us with a donation you can do so here.

                                          Hosting provided by Mythic-Beasts. See the Hosting Information page for more information.

                                            This community forum collects and processes your personal information.
                                            consent.not_received